Acceptance Rate and Application Statistics

The following table compares the admission related statistics including number of applicants, admitted, and enrolled between selected colleges. The average acceptance rate of selected colleges is 77.30% and the average admission yield (enrollment rate) is 12.22%.
Albion College has the tighest (lowest) acceptance rate of 66.52% and Sacred Heart Major Seminary has the highest yield (enrollment rate) of 100.00% among selected colleges. The numbers in parenthesis() in below table represent the number and rate by gender (men/women). The stat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023.
Admission Stats Comparison Between Selected Colleges
Name ApplicantsAdmittedEnrolledAcceptance RateEnrollment Rate
Albion College 6,827 (3,117/3,710) 4,541 (1,805/2,736) 418 (200/218) 67% (58%/74%) 9% (11%/6%)
Davenport University 3,379 (1,571/1,808) 3,342 (1,559/1,783) 534 (260/274) 99% (99%/99%) 16% (17%/15%)
Marygrove College no longer opens and does not accept applicants (Closed: 12/17/2019)
Sacred Heart Major Seminary 4 (2/2) 4 (2/2) 4 (2/2) 100% (100%/100%) 100% (100%/100%)
Compass College of Film and Media 25 (20/5) 25 (20/5) 11 (9/2) 100% (100%/100%) 44% (45%/40%)
Baker College of Muskegon No admission statistics available for the school.
Average2,559 (1,178/1,178)1,978 (847/1,132)242 (118/124)77.30% (71.9%/96.1%)12.22% (13.9%/11.0%)
